After taking a 3 month break on the weekends to support my sons baseball team, I finally got a weekend day to go fishing. Of course nothing was pre-staged the night before and I did not make it for a dawn patrol-but I STILL got on the lake a little late-like 11:40AM! I wanted to do some trolling for some deep thermo-clining Rainbows, so I tried skinner since it was the closest. The water temp was 71, so I dropped the DR and worked the dam feverishly area for nothing (Thank God a Angel game was on). Folks tied up at the dam area were getting doubles and triples on stripers (looked like small ones) but they were having a blast! Drifted bait with west wind coming in pretty good for nothing and all the baseball games on the radio were over- I returned to the D.R at 3PM and put on a skinny shad lure and went at it again. Finally got the rod to pop up on some feisty little guys, by the time I dropped the lure down to depth I had another and then another. No big models, but it felt good to catch something, all little suckers released. Here are some pics:
